    First time for this one; part of the Winter Classics box.

    Tall tan head over a deep ruby body with rising bubbles. It certainly looks the part of a Christmas beer.

    Sweet malty aroma, slight spice.

    Moderate body and mouth feel, if slightly flat. Sweet malts and spices in the taste, cinnamon is there but only slightly, with a nicely bitter finish to keep the sweetness under control. Easy drinking, pleasant, but hardly "bold" as the label promises (although maybe it was nearly 20 years ago when introduced...).

    Went to this new craft beer beer bar in Bonn, close to Cologne today. Didn't exactly blow me away, but nice enough place, I sure had some nice beers there.

    To Ol, 3x Thirsty Simcoe (no picture), a triple dry-hopped IPA which was perfectly fine, but the triple dry-hopping certainly wasn't particularly obvious.

    De Molen, Vuur & Vlam, a WC style IPA which was quite resinous and rather nice.

    [​IMG]

    Pohjala, Öö, an Imperial Porter with strong notes of roasted malts and chocolate and a rather dry and bitter character, very nice.
